    Hope this helps...

    I ordered six bottles of wine from the groceries section (not the Tesco Wine website). Be aware that clicking on the 30% off link on the groceries homepage takes you to a list of their "summer" wines, which is only a small choice! You get the 30% off any wine so look at the normal wine section too. Most of the bottles I chose were half price anyway (there's a nice £10 Rioja at half price!) so I got an extra 30% off that and in total have saved nearly £30 just on wine!

    I then used a £10 off code I found on here which still worked as of noon yesterday (8Y73KPRBFZL3). Delivered this morning with no problems, receipt says £8.83 off the wine and an extra £10 off the total shop.

    Tesco must be selling some of these wines at a hefty loss!

    The Marques De Leon, a decent cheap rocket fuel, (currently £2.10) is working out at only £1.47 a bottle under this offer.

    After VAT is deducted that's £1.25 a bottle.

    But the statutory rate of excise duty which Tesco must pay on each bottle when it arrives in the UK is £1.33.

    So that's an 8p loss per bottle on the tax alone, plus a loss of the entire cost of the wine, bottling, shipping, etc.

    I'd estimate it to be a total loss of around 60p-70p per bottle.
